Notes: 

It was translated in the same year into French with the title: L'imagination poëtique.
Verses in Latin and Greek written to accompany pictures most of which were already in Bonhomme's stock--Cf. Preface.
106 woodcuts attributed to Bernard Salomon or Pierre Eskrich; illustration on p. 47 repeated on p. 58; printer's devise explained on p. 10.
First edition.

Binding: 
Dark brown morocco with the emblem called on p. 8 of the book Stemma Baborum, i.e. P. Pabou, to whom the book is dedicated.
Inscriptions/Markings: 

"Ex libris Pougin c R." written on title page; "Gosford" written on inner cover.

Provenance: 
P. Babou; C.R. Pougin; Lord Gosford.
